Reply #82010-10-15
The thickness of the girth plate meets the requirements of 8.3 in GB150; no additional reinforcement is required for the openings. However, the flat cover itself must meet strength requirements. Due to the weakening caused by the openings, the thickness of a flat cover is slightly greater than that of one without openings.
Reply #92010-10-15
The thickness of the first nozzle meets the requirements specified in 8.3 of GB150. In the second calculation, the weakening factor due to the openings in the flat cover was taken into account based on the maximum cross-section of those openings; the flat cover was reinforced as a whole during the calculations. The thickness of the flat cover meets the required standards, so there is no need to consider reinforcing the nozzles separately. For high-pressure equipment, it is necessary to consider increasing the wall thickness of the nozzles, as attention must be paid to the strength of the weld corners and to the suitability of the size of the fillet welds
